Davinci: generalized debug macros
authorCyril Chemparathy <cyril@ti.com>
Tue, 18 May 2010 16:51:17 +0000 (12:51 -0400)
committerKevin Hilman <khilman@deeprootsystems.com>
Mon, 21 Jun 2010 19:48:30 +0000 (12:48 -0700)
This patch adopts a debug uart selection similar to the OMAP model.  During
the boot process, the uncompress code determines the physical and virtual base
addresses of the board-specific debug uart.  These addresses are then passed
on to the in-kernel debug macros through a small chunk of memory placed just
below the page tables (@0x80003ff8).

+/*
+ * Stolen area that contains debug uart physical and virtual addresses.  These
+ * addresses are filled in by the uncompress.h code, and are used by the debug
+ * macros in debug-macro.S.
+ *
+ * This area sits just below the page tables (see arch/arm/kernel/head.S).
+ */
+#define DAVINCI_UART_INFO      (PHYS_OFFSET + 0x3ff8)

+static inline void __arch_decomp_setup(unsigned long arch_id)
+{
+       /*
+        * Initialize the port based on the machine ID from the bootloader.
+        * Note that we're using macros here instead of switch statement
+        * as machine_is functions are optimized out for the boards that
+        * are not selected.
+        */
